Предыдущая версия справа и слева Предыдущая версия | |
articles_optimisation_howtooptimise [2024/05/11 17:03] – admin | articles_optimisation_howtooptimise [2024/05/11 17:24] (текущий) – admin |
---|
* Если вы загружаете изображение меньшего размера и масштабируете его во время выполнения, оно использует объем памяти как меньший размер (по крайней мере, мне так сказали). Таким образом, изображение размером 100×100, масштабированное до 400×400, по-прежнему будет использовать тот же объем оперативной памяти, что и изображение размером 100×100 пикселей. | * Если вы загружаете изображение меньшего размера и масштабируете его во время выполнения, оно использует объем памяти как меньший размер (по крайней мере, мне так сказали). Таким образом, изображение размером 100×100, масштабированное до 400×400, по-прежнему будет использовать тот же объем оперативной памяти, что и изображение размером 100×100 пикселей. |
* Если изображение действительно большое, подумайте, можно ли его разбить на более мелкие части. Например, если у вас длинное фоновое изображение, можете ли вы разрезать его на несколько частей, соответствующих лучшим степеням 2? Это сэкономит много памяти | * Если изображение действительно большое, подумайте, можно ли его разбить на более мелкие части. Например, если у вас длинное фоновое изображение, можете ли вы разрезать его на несколько частей, соответствующих лучшим степеням 2? Это сэкономит много памяти |
* Альфа-каналы истощают память, как вампир. Используйте трансп. Цвет в редакторе анимации. | * Альфа-каналы истощают память, как вампир. Используйте прозрачность в редакторе спрайта. |
| |
===== Оптимизация вашего кода с помощью активных/неактивных групп ===== | ===== Оптимизация вашего кода с помощью активных/неактивных групп ===== |